SECTION 10 – APPLIANCES JAYCO CLASS A MOTOR HOMES
10-2
There is no need for routine condenser cleaning in normal operating environments.
If the environment is particularly greasy or dusty, or if there is significant pet traffic,
the condenser should be cleaned every 2 to 3 months to ensure maximum
efficiency.
If you need to clean the condenser:
Remove the base grille.
Use a vacuum cleaner with a soft brush to clean the grille, the open areas
behind the grille and the front surface area of the condenser.
Replace the base grille when finished.
Cleaning the exterior
Wash painted metal exteriors with a clean sponge or soft cloth and a mild
detergent in warm water.
For silver-accented plastic parts, wash with soap or other mild detergents. Wipe
clean with a sponge or damp cloth. Do not use scouring pads, powdered cleaners,
bleach or cleaners containing bleach as these products can scratch and weaken
the paint finish.
MICROWAVE (IF SO EQUIPPED)
Make sure there is sufficient 120-volt power available before operating the
microwave.
NOTE: To prevent damage, remove the turntable from the microwave
when traveling.
Convection Microwave (if so equipped)
For details on operation, cleaning and safety information, refer to the
manufacturer’s user guide included in the Warranty Packet, or visit the
manufacturer’s website. (refer to Sec. 15 of this manual for the website
information).
The convection microwave bridges the gap between microwaving your food and
conventional cooking. Make sure there is sufficient 120-volt power available before
operating the convection microwave (refer to Sec. 6 Electrical Systems,
Calculating electrical load).
Microwave Oven Use
For list of preset programs, see the Quick Reference Guide provided with your
model.
General Cleaning
IMPORTANT: Before cleaning, make sure all controls are off and the microwave
oven is cool. Always follow label instructions on cleaning products.
To avoid damage to the microwave oven caused by arcing due to soil buildup keep
cavity, microwave inlet cover, cooking rack supports, and area where the door
touches the frame clean.
WARNING
Never use the microwave cavity for storage. The microwave cavity should
always be empty when not in use.
